The Rise of Social Curiosity on the High Street

In recent years, the UK has seen a resurgence in local ‘third spaces’—environments that are neither home nor work. As Gemini season begins, these locations become the primary stage for social interaction. From community-led workshops in repurposed high-street shops to the growing network of urban allotments, the environment is ripe for low-stakes networking.

Social curiosity differs from standard networking because it lacks a rigid agenda. It is driven by a genuine interest in the stories and skills of others. Today, this might manifest as a conversation with a local artisan at a craft market or joining a last-minute book club meeting at a neighborhood library. These interactions serve to strengthen the ‘weak ties’ in our lives—the acquaintances who often provide the most unexpected and valuable pieces of information or new perspectives.
